NetSocket Raises $9.2M

NetSocket, a provider of network service assurance solutions for unified communications (UC), has secured $9.2 million in Series B funding. The round was led by new investor Venture Investors, with participation by existing investors Sevin Rosen Funds, Silver Creek Ventures and Trailblazer Capital.

The capital will be used to accelerate the launch of a new solution, aimed at the Software Defined Networking (SDN) market, says the company.

Jim Adox, managing partner at Venture Investors, will be joining the board of directors at NetSocket.
